Output 18da84962b35c73cdb5920779ec2fd62b21e06b6df6f0f414677e5922ab58abd:1

value
18737124390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f2654d10a7c91938941f3cc740bfa3cb3eeb420 OP_EQUAL
address
MJ2sA2gWKfRRAuSSaErVJ2gNq83o6NqMQ2
transaction
18da84962b35c73cdb5920779ec2fd62b21e06b6df6f0f414677e5922ab58abd
spent
true